Output 52908083ec56df877b4981ae559e1f3582ff7d956f69c6cf99fe8abd4d9b9914:0

value
107520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ec7181f95bb60f607e6f07066c613bc107a23c0b OP_EQUAL
address
3PFDNUCYgctFiHpXmNECyRJRfU1xqQuzWy
transaction
52908083ec56df877b4981ae559e1f3582ff7d956f69c6cf99fe8abd4d9b9914